    President Cyril Ramaphosa is set to host a family meeting at 19h00 on Sunday, 13 July 2025, following serious allegations made against senior political figures, including Minister Senzo Mchunu and top leadership within the South African Police Service (SAPS).   The address follows a public statement made by KwaZulu-Natal Police Commissioner, Lieutenant-General Nhlanhla Mkhwanazi, during a media briefing on Sunday, 6 July, while the President was attending a BRICS summit in Brazil.

  The family of a young South African woman, Paige Bell, has travelled to the Bahamas seeking justice for her murder.   20-year-old Bell, from KwaZulu-Natal, was killed on a luxury motorboat in the Caribbean island country on 3 July 2025.
